Art Facilitator Volunteer Description
Volunteer Summary
For more than 30 years, DrawBridge has provided free expressive arts programs to children at homeless shelters, affordable housing facilities, and neighborhood community centers across seven San Francisco Bay Area counties. Offering child-focused art experiences and quality art supplies, children ages four and up are able to connect with their community and explore playful creativity that is critical to healthy development.
DrawBridge is seeking 2-3 experienced volunteers to lead children and youth through a range of expressive art activities in a group setting. Desired qualities include creativity, kindness, ability to listen and lead, patience and ability to give unconditional support.
